[QUOTE="EricNoah, post: 4605453, member: 4"] Ultimately I have decided to put them in an Underdark like place on the moon. I'll be smooshing together a lot of stuff from various sources: MM: modified xill (a bit nerfed, but with electricity guns and sonic swords); modified violet fungi (they are much more ambulatory, like evil mushroom men) Paizo's Into the Darklands - rules for travel through underdark (including speeds, chances to get lost, chances to be delayed, hazards, survival issues), radioactive minerals, unusual flora, and creatures including their moorlocks (degenerate humanoids descended from escaped slaves of various humanoid stock), modified intellect devouerer (no claws - but can float/fly), and their Seugathi - a madness-inducing tentacled catepillar type thing. Psionics Handbook: astral constructs (these have been tainted with a malevolent intelligence and are roaming the underdark - there are pockets of astral goo that have always leaked into these caves, and the inhabitants have used this material to shape objects and create effects, but now it's coming to life and attacking whatever races live down here). I have a player who kind of homebrewed a psion/shaper class and I want him to have a special chance to shine in this adventure. I will come up with some rules to allow him to craft bits of this astral goo into spell-like effects or utility objects. MM II (I think): clockwork horror (the flying brains can alternatively ride inside these) Tome of Horrors: some suitably alien lifeforms including mantari, flail snail, psionic elemental, cave moray, carrion moth, blindheim, basidirond [/QUOTE]
